Odds and Ends: Or Gleanings from Missionary Life is a book written by C.H. Wheeler and published in 1888. The book is a collection of stories, anecdotes, and observations from the author's experiences as a missionary in various parts of the world. Wheeler shares his insights on the challenges and rewards of missionary work, as well as his encounters with different cultures and religions. The book covers a wide range of topics, including social customs, religious beliefs, and political issues. It also includes descriptions of the natural beauty and wildlife of the regions where Wheeler worked.
